Dinsmore is seeking a Legal Administrative Assistant at our Indianapolis, IN location who will support multiple attorneys/paralegals primarily in connection with all phases of trademark protection and enforcement. Responsibilities
Completing electronic filings Communicating professionally and in a timely manner with clients Carrying out billing Proofreading, editing, and formatting contracts, spreadsheets, other reports and transaction related documents Managing docketing Coordinating travel arrangements, time entry and other legal support functions Requirements
Excellent writing, grammar, proofreading skills, and meticulous attention to detail Excellent word processing skills and intermediate-level use of Microsoft Office Suite, .pdf editing software, and related legal software, including attorney timekeeping software and electronic document management systems Familiarity with basic online resources Possess strong organizational and time management skills, and ability to multi-task Proven success as a positive team player, as well as an independent worker Ability to excel in a fast-paced environment Solid work history including 3-5 years supporting multiple attorneys/paralegals is preferred Experience in trademark and copyright clearance, prosecution and transactional work is preferred Experience with the U.S. Patent and Trademark Office is preferred Overall knowledge and understanding of domestic and foreign procurement process for patents and trademarks is preferred Ability to review and communicate docket to attorneys/paralegals, and effectively report to several professionals is preferred We seek candidates that are self-directed, highly motivated, and have advanced computer skills Equal Opportunity Employer Seniority level
